Course Description

Today's knowledge workers have quietly slipped into the role of the unofficial project manager. Stakeholders, scope creep, no formal training, and a lack of process all combine to raise the probability of project failure, costing organizations time, money and employee morale.

PEOPLE + PROCESS = SUCCESS

Project management isn't just about managing logistics and hoping the project team is ready to play to win. Pervasive and sustainable project success will come to those who intentionally choose to implement a disciplined process of execution and master informal authority.

Course Objectives

Upon completion of this course, participants will be able to:

  • Implement four foundational behaviors that inspire their team members to execute with excellence.
  • Identify a project's stakeholders.
  • Establish clear and measurable project outcomes.
  • Create a well-defined project scope statement.
  • Identify, assess and manage project risks.
  • Create a realistic and well-defined project schedule.
  • Hold team members accountable to project plans.
  • Conduct consistent team-accountability sessions.
  • Create a clear communication plan around their project that includes regular project status reports and project changes.
  • Reward and recognize the contributions of project team members.
  • Formally close projects by documenting lessons learned.
